Proper noun
Kocurek (plural Kocureks)
- A surname.
Statistics
- According to the 2010 United States Census, Kocurek is the 32079th most common surname in the United States, belonging to 719 individuals. Kocurek is most common among White (95.27%) individuals.

Proper noun
Kocurek m pers
- a male surname
Declension
Declension of Kocurek
| singular | plural | |
|---|---|---|
| nominative | Kocurek | Kocurkowie |
| genitive | Kocurka | Kocurków |
| dative | Kocurkowi | Kocurkom |
| accusative | Kocurka | Kocurków |
| instrumental | Kocurkiem | Kocurkami |
| locative | Kocurku | Kocurkach |
| vocative | Kocurku | Kocurkowie |
